THE OPPORTUNITY:
The Exploitation Engineer will be a member of our Heavy Oil South team and contribute in the following ways:

  •  Participate in the production of gas or oil pools under primary, secondary (waterflood) and EOR (polymer) recovery methods within their geographic area of responsibility

  •  Optimize and expand our production targets as well as recommend and implement new recovery methods

    HOW WILL YOU MAKE YOUR MARK?

  •  Monitor and optimize the depletion strategies of the Company's new and existing pools

  •  Evaluate potential acquisitions and present recommended acquisition value to management

  •  Provide engineering support and work with the area exploration team to develop existing and future company assets

  •  Provide recommendations on the completions and re-completion of new and existing wells, as well as liaise with the production team to recommend production facilities

  •  Calculate, maintain and ensure the accuracy and integrity of the corporate reserves

  •  Conduct reservoir studies and analysis on new and emerging exploration prospects

    QUALIFICATIONS:

  •  Typically 5+ years of related Oil and Gas Exploitation industry experience with an Engineering Degree

  •  Familiarity with and understanding of:
       o Economic evaluation, reservoir experience and some exposure to operations.
       o Working in a multi-disciplinary team
